Latest Patents

Ali's latest patents include innovative methods for measuring gas in shale reservoirs. This method involves loading a rock sample into an overburden cell, applying hydrocarbon gas at a specific pressure, and using a nuclear magnetic resonance spectrometer to measure the hydrocarbon gas volume within the rock sample. The volume is then corrected using a Real Gas Index to determine the accurate volume of stored gas. Another patent focuses on modeling permeability in layered rock formations. This method simulates fluid movement through a formation volume by defining a lab-scale model and converting it to a field-scale model, which is then correlated with field-scale log data to create a comprehensive model of rock fabric and permeability.

Career Highlights

Safdar Ali works at W.D. Von Gonten Laboratories, LLC, where he applies his expertise in geological sciences to develop innovative solutions for the energy sector. His work has been instrumental in advancing techniques for gas measurement and permeability modeling, which are crucial for efficient resource extraction.
